[AG-DEV] Cert issues on Fedora 12

Jason Bell j.bell at cqu.edu.au
Wed Feb 24 22:48:05 CST 2010


G'day All



Just wondering if any has installed Fedora 12 and the Access Grid software recently.



I have tried to install the AG software at home and got some error messages which appears to relate to the certificate.



Just wondering if anyone has seen this.



Thanks,

Jason.



PS, this is the error message I get:


/usr/lib/python2.6/site-packages/ZSI/resolvers.py:7: DeprecationWarning: the multifile module has been deprecated since Python 2.5
  import multifile, mimetools, urllib
Starting Service URI: http://127.0.0.1:49475/Services/AudioService.7f0000011e0e1d7ab29946690480bba7df
02/14/2010 03:36:05 PM 140196559439632 ServiceManager     AGServiceManager.py:234 INFO  Service registered: token,url = 7f0000011e001d7ab29922d3397a8af89e,http://127.0.0.1:49475/Services/AudioService.7f0000011e0e1d7ab29946690480bba7df
02/14/2010 03:36:05 PM 140196569929488 ServiceManager     AGServiceManager.py:422 INFO  Service registered: http://127.0.0.1:49475/Services/AudioService.7f0000011e0e1d7ab29946690480bba7df 7f0000011e001d7ab29922d3397a8af89e
02/14/2010 03:36:05 PM 140196569929488 ServiceManager     AGServiceManager.py:103 INFO  AGServiceManager.AddService
02/14/2010 03:36:05 PM 140196569929488 ServiceManager     AGServiceManager.py:343 INFO  Installed service version: 3.1, package version: 3.1
02/14/2010 03:36:05 PM 140196569929488 ServiceManager     AGServiceManager.py:378 DEBUG Executing service VideoConsumerService
02/14/2010 03:36:05 PM 140196569929488 ServiceManager     AGServiceManager.py:410 INFO  Running Service; options: ['/home/ace/.AccessGrid3/local_services/VideoConsumerService/VideoConsumerService.py', '--port', 64412, '--serviceManagerUri', 'http://127.0.0.1:11000/ServiceManager', '--token', '7f0000011e001d7ab299577eaf61c6b03a']
/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/ClientProfile.py:22: DeprecationWarning: the md5 module is deprecated; use hashlib instead
  import md5
/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Security/ProxyGen.py:19: DeprecationWarning: The popen2 module is deprecated.  Use the subprocess module.
  import popen2
/usr/lib/python2.6/site-packages/ZSI/resolvers.py:7: DeprecationWarning: the multifile module has been deprecated since Python 2.5
  import multifile, mimetools, urllib
Starting Service URI: http://127.0.0.1:64412/Services/VideoConsumerService.7f0000011e141d7ab2997056eb7cf7a3d5
02/14/2010 03:36:06 PM 140196559439632 ServiceManager     AGServiceManager.py:234 INFO  Service registered: token,url = 7f0000011e001d7ab299577eaf61c6b03a,http://127.0.0.1:64412/Services/VideoConsumerService.7f0000011e141d7ab2997056eb7cf7a3d5
02/14/2010 03:36:06 PM 140196569929488 ServiceManager     AGServiceManager.py:422 INFO  Service registered: http://127.0.0.1:64412/Services/VideoConsumerService.7f0000011e141d7ab2997056eb7cf7a3d5 7f0000011e001d7ab299577eaf61c6b03a
02/14/2010 03:36:06 PM 140196948985600 VenueClient     VenueClient.py:365 DEBUG get bridges from registry
02/14/2010 03:36:06 PM 140196948985600 VenueClient     VenueClient.py:371 DEBUG Trying bridge registry: http://www.accessgrid.org/registry/peers.txt
02/14/2010 03:36:06 PM 140196948985600 VenueClient     Preferences.py:188 DEBUG Preferences.LoadPreferences: open file
02/14/2010 03:36:09 PM 140196948985600 VenueClient     VenueClient.py:371 DEBUG Trying bridge registry: http://www.ap-accessgrid.org/registry/peers.txt
02/14/2010 03:36:09 PM 140196948985600 VenueClient     Preferences.py:188 DEBUG Preferences.LoadPreferences: open file
02/14/2010 03:36:09 PM 140196948985600 VenueClient     VenueClient.py:397 DEBUG connect to bridge
02/14/2010 03:36:09 PM 140196948985600 VenueClient     VenueClient.py:401 DEBUG exiting loadbridges
02/14/2010 03:36:09 PM 140196948985600 NodeService     AGNodeService.py:289 INFO  NodeService.SetServiceEnabledByMediaType
02/14/2010 03:36:09 PM 140196948985600 NodeService     AGNodeService.py:258 INFO  NodeService.GetServices
02/14/2010 03:36:09 PM 140196559439632 ServiceManager     AGServiceManager.py:220 INFO  AGServiceManager.GetServices
02/14/2010 03:36:09 PM 140196948985600 NodeService     AGNodeService.py:275 INFO  NodeService.SetServiceEnabled
02/14/2010 03:36:09 PM 140196948985600 NodeService     AGNodeService.py:701 INFO  NodeService.__SendStreamsToService
02/14/2010 03:36:09 PM 140196948985600 NodeService     AGNodeService.py:705 DEBUG service capabilities: [consumer, audio, 7f0000011e0e1d7ab2993d1349a0aab1bc, L16, 16000, 1, None, None, consumer, audio, 7f0000011e0e1d7ab2993d1349a0aab1bc, L16, 8000, 1, None, None, consumer, audio, 7f0000011e0e1d7ab2993d1349a0aab1bc, L8, 16000, 1, None, None, consumer, audio, 7f0000011e0e1d7ab2993d1349a0aab1bc, L8, 8000, 1, None, None, consumer, audio, 7f0000011e0e1d7ab2993d1349a0aab1bc, PCMU, 16000, 1, None, None, consumer, audio, 7f0000011e0e1d7ab2993d1349a0aab1bc, PCMU, 8000, 1, None, None, consumer, audio, 7f0000011e0e1d7ab2993d1349a0aab1bc, GSM, 16000, 1, None, None, consumer, audio, 7f0000011e0e1d7ab2993d1349a0aab1bc, GSM, 8000, 1, None, None, producer, audio, 7f0000011e0e1d7ab2993d1349a0aab1bc, L16, 16000, 1, None, None]
02/14/2010 03:36:09 PM 140196948985600 NodeService     AGNodeService.py:258 INFO  NodeService.GetServices
02/14/2010 03:36:09 PM 140196559439632 ServiceManager     AGServiceManager.py:220 INFO  AGServiceManager.GetServices
02/14/2010 03:36:10 PM 140196948985600 NodeService     AGNodeService.py:258 INFO  NodeService.GetServices
02/14/2010 03:36:10 PM 140196559439632 ServiceManager     AGServiceManager.py:220 INFO  AGServiceManager.GetServices
02/14/2010 03:36:10 PM 140196948985600 NodeService     AGNodeService.py:640 INFO  NodeService.GetConfigurations
02/14/2010 03:36:10 PM 140196948985600 CertificateManager     CertificateManager.py:212 DEBUG Opened repository /home/ace/.AccessGrid3/Config/certRepo
02/14/2010 03:36:10 PM 140196948985600 Toolkit     Toolkit.py:472 INFO  Initialized certificate manager.
02/14/2010 03:36:10 PM 140196948985600 VenueClient     VenueClientUI.py:536 ERROR VenueClientFrame.__SetMenubar: Cannot retrieve                            certificate mgr user interface, continuing
Traceback (most recent call last):
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/VenueClientUI.py", line 533, in __SetMenubar
    mgr = app.GetCertificateManager()
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Toolkit.py", line 473, in GetCertificateManager
    self._certificateManager.InitEnvironment()
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Security/CertificateManager.py", line 564, in InitEnvironment
    self._InitializeCADir()
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Security/CertificateManager.py", line 645, in _InitializeCADir
    for c in self.GetCACerts():
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Security/CertificateManager.py", line 768, in GetCACerts
    caCerts = self.certRepo.FindCertificatesWithMetadata(mdkey, mdval)
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Security/CertificateRepository.py", line 1201, in FindCertificatesWithMetadata
    return list(self.FindCertificates(lambda c: c.GetMetadata(mdkey) == mdvalue))
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Security/CertificateRepository.py", line 1191, in FindCertificates
    if pred(cert):
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Security/CertificateRepository.py", line 1201, in <lambda>
    return list(self.FindCertificates(lambda c: c.GetMetadata(mdkey) == mdvalue))
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Security/CertificateRepository.py", line 1297, in GetMetadata
    return self.cert.GetMetadata(k)
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Security/CertificateRepository.py", line 1590, in GetMetadata
    hashkey = self._GetMetadataKey(key)
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Security/CertificateRepository.py", line 1579, in _GetMetadataKey
    self.GetIssuerSerialHash(),
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/Security/CertificateRepository.py", line 1504, in GetIssuerSerialHash
    serial = struct.pack("l", self.cert.get_serial_number())
error: long too large to convert to int
Traceback (most recent call last):
  File "/usr/bin/VenueClient", line 173, in <module>
    main()
  File "/usr/bin/VenueClient", line 150, in main
    vcui = VenueClientUI(vc, vcc, app)
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/VenueClientUI.py", line 237, in __init__
    self.__BuildUI(app)
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/VenueClientUI.py", line 980, in __BuildUI
    self.__SetMenubar(app)
  File "/usr/lib/python2.6/site-packages/AccessGrid3/AccessGrid/VenueClientUI.py", line 538, in __SetMenubar
    self.cmui = CertificateManagerWXGUI.CertificateManagerWXGUI(mgr)
UnboundLocalError: local variable 'mgr' referenced before assignment





--------------------------------------------

Jason Bell, B.I.T. (Honours)



Research Systems Support Officer

Information Technology Division

CQ University Australia



Australian Research Collaboration Service

http://www.arcs.org.au/



E-mail : j.bell at cqu.edu.au

         jason.bell at arcs.org.au

Work   : +61 7 4930 9229

Mobile : 0409 630897

Postal : Building 19

         Central Queensland University

         Bruce Highway

         Rockhampton, Queensland, Australia, 4702

--------------------------------------------

Patience is a virtue.



But if I wanted Patience,

I would have become a Doctor.

--------------------------------------------


-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.mcs.anl.gov/pipermail/ag-dev/attachments/20100225/83fb2d6d/attachment.htm>


More information about the ag-dev mailing list